Seat, seatbelt and SRS airbags

To remove:
While pressing the release button, pull out
the head restraint.
To install:
Install the head restraint into the holes that
are located on the top of the seatback until
the head restraint locks.

WARNING

. Never drive the vehicle with the

head restraints removed because
they are designed to reduce the
risk of serious neck injury in the
event that the vehicle is struck
from the rear. Therefore, when
you remove the head restraints,
you must reinstall all head re-
straints to protect vehicle occu-
pants.

. All occupants, including the dri-

ver, should not operate a vehicle
or sit in a vehicle

’s seat until the

head restraints are placed in their
proper positions in order to mini-
mize the risk of neck injury in the
event of a collision.

Seat heater (if equipped)

1)

HIGH

– Rapid heating

2)

LOW

– Normal heating

3)

OFF

– Off

A)

Left-hand side

B)

Right-hand side

The seat heater operates when the igni-
tion switch is either in the

“Acc” or “ON”

position.

To turn on the seat heater, press the

“LOW” or “HIGH” position on the switch,
as desired, depending on the tempera-
ture.
Selecting the

“HIGH” position will cause

the seat to heat up quicker.

To turn off the seat heater, slightly press
the opposite side of the current position.

The indicator located on the switch illumi-
nates when the seat heater is in operation.
When the vehicle

’s interior is warmed

enough or before you leave the vehicle,
be sure to turn the switch off.

CAUTION

. There is a possibility that people

with delicate skin may suffer
slight burns even at low tempera-
tures if they use the seat heater
for a long period of time. When
using the heater, always be sure
to warn the persons concerned.
